Abstract: | The final stage of revamping of the GK–3 cat cracker reactor block with introduction of new technology is described. The elements of implantation are: combined external riser reactor; high–efficiency feedstock and slurry nozzles; crude treatment cyclone; cracking product cooling unit; two–stage catalyst stripping; regenerated catalyst transport system. As a result, the yield of naphtha is increased by 4.6 wt. %, and steam consumption in the reactor block is reduced by 15%; the unit is converted to a two–year servicing schedule; the feedstock is high–end–point vacuum distillate; the reliability and safety of operation are increased. |
